Edward Dorn's Gunslinger is an anti-epic poem that follows a cast of colorful characters as they set out the American West in search of Howard Hughes. This expanded fiftieth anniversary edition of Dorn's wild and comedic romp includes a new foreword by Marjorie Perloff, an essay by Michael Davidson, and Charles Olson's "Bibliography on America for Ed Dorn".

Edward Dorn (1929–1999) was one of the original voices of his generation. Often associated with the Black Mountain poets, Dorn was the author of more than forty books of poetry, fiction, and nonfiction.
